Jump after Paris: Khabibullayev wins world title in new weight class

At the World Championship in Liverpool, To'rabek Habibullayev became one of the brightest heroes of the competition. Our boxer, who fought in the -80 kg category during the Paris-2024 cycle, rose to -90 kg in one year, showed himself in a new test, and won the championship crown. After the championship, he gave an impressive interview to the NOC press service.
"The toughest fight? - semi-final and final"
According to Khabibullayev, to be first in the world, each opponent will enter the ring with serious preparation. "In competitions of this level, no one enters the ring hoping to lose. Everyone fights with all their might. The semi-final and final in Liverpool were more difficult than in previous stages. But the clear instructions given by my coaches, adapting to the opponent, and the correct tactical plan led me to gold," the champion said. According to him, a sense of distance, proper pressure distribution, and economical movement in the final rounds were the key to victory.
Weight changes: natural decision and easy adjustment
After Paris, Turabek revised his work style: "Previously, I had to lose a lot of weight before competitions, which became more difficult over time. The teachers advised me to move to a higher category - I agreed. Since my natural weight was higher, I didn't experience any serious difficulties adapting to -90 kg." The athlete added that the protocols for physical training, nutrition, and recovery have been restructured, along with an increase in strength and endurance indicators.
Los Angeles-2028: Gold Goal Only
Khabibullayev's next roadmap is clear: "I intend to return from my second Olympics only with gold. This goal requires even more effort, especially working on speed and effective combinations." He said that he pays special attention to international training camps, high-speed sparring, and deepening the analysis of opponents.
Gratitude and next steps
The champion expressed special gratitude to the coaching staff, the medical and rehabilitation group, and the fans: "This victory is the result of teamwork. Every person who supports us has a share."
To'rabek Habibullayev's triumphant move in the new weight class once again demonstrated the power of order, discipline, and proper planning in the Uzbek boxing school. And now ahead - the Olympic Games and more ambitious goals.
